The Moorings celebrates 50th anniversary with special events in top destinations

by Zak Hillard 20 Mar 2019 05:00 PDT
British Virgin Islands with The Moorings © George Kamper

Yacht charter company, The Moorings, is turning 50 years old in 2019 and is planning to celebrate the momentous occasion by hosting two 50th anniversary rendezvous events in Croatia and the British Virgin Islands.

Five decades have now passed since the company was established by Charlie and Ginny Cary in the British Virgin Islands. Born from a passion for sailing and a slim fleet of six yachts, The Moorings wouldn't be the trusted yacht charter brand it is today if not for the legacy of its beloved founders and the continued support of its valued guests.

As they prepare to mark this major milestone, The Moorings team is inviting customers and fellow members of the yachting community to join them in celebrating a half-century of unforgettable vacations on the water.

Each of the events will feature a special itinerary designed to celebrate key partners and venues throughout both of these marquis cruising grounds, with the guidance of a lead Moorings boat. Guests will also enjoy dinners ashore, wine tastings, exclusive parties and contests, and custom patrons-only gear. The celebration events take place in Croatia from October 12th 19th 2019 and in the British Virgin Islands from November 10th 16th 2019.
